Increased payments for COVID-19 discharges under the Inpatient Prospective Payment System
(IPPS) Section 3710 of the Coronavirus Aid, Relief, and Economic Security (CARES) Act established an increase in the weighting factor of the assigned diagnosis-related group by 20 percent for an individual diagnosed with COVID-19 discharged during the COVID-19 public health emergency period. Effective with admissions occurring on or after September 1, 2020, claims eligible for the 20 percent increase in the Medicare Severity-Diagnosis Related Group (MS-DRG) weighting factor will also be required to have a positive COVID-19 laboratory test documented in the patient’s medical record.
